11 Questions to Ask Your Doctor Before Taking Opioids

  • Why do I need this medication — is it right for me?
  • How long should I take this medication?
  • Are there non-opioid alternatives that could help with pain relief while I recover?
  • Could this treatment interact with my other medicine for anxiety, sleeping issues, or seizures?
  • How should I store my opioid medication to prevent other people from taking it?
  • How can I reduce the reist of potential side effects from this medication?
  • What if I have a history of drug addiction with tobacco, alcohol or drugs?
  • What if there is a history of addition in my family?
  • Can I share this medication with someone else? Why not?
  • What should I do with unused opioid medicine?
  • Can I have an Rx for naloxone?
